You probably know this, so apologies if I am being obvious.

Height counts as a base for the jumping attribute, but does nothing on its own. A 5'8'' player with 10 jumping will jump as high as a 6'4'' player with 10 jumping.

Scouting. They have only given me a scouting budget of £52,500 for next season, and the package we're currently on, (Surrounding Divisions), costs £44,600 over the course of the year. That leaves us with just £7,900 to spend on actual scouting trips to watch games. That equates to 15 scouting trips, (at £525 per trip in Spain). 

The prices go up depending on what Nation you want to scout in and it's interesting because I've never noticed this before, (but then again I have never looked so it might have been in the game for years).

That's for going to watch 1 game. So manually scouting like this is ridiculously expensive compared to scouting a Nation or a Tournament or whatever, so the scout just remains in situ and can watch multiple games or even multiple players in the same game. The above list is the cost of sending 1 scout, to 1 game, to scout 1 player.
